Impact of the Pandemic on Dentistry

The COVID-19 pandemic has had a profound impact on the practice of dentistry:

  • Reduced Patient Appointments: Fear of infection and social distancing measures led to a significant decline in patient appointments during the early stages of the pandemic.
  • Infection Control Challenges: Dental procedures involve close contact with patients, posing a potential risk of infection transmission. Dentists had to implement rigorous infection control protocols to mitigate this risk.
  • Increased Use of Technology: Telehealth and virtual consultations became essential tools for connecting with patients remotely, reducing the need for in-person visits.
  • Financial Impact: The reduction in patient appointments and the additional costs associated with infection control measures placed a significant financial burden on many dental practices.
  • Staffing Shortages: Health concerns and childcare issues led to staffing shortages in dental offices, further exacerbating operational challenges.

Adapting to the Post-Pandemic Landscape

Infection Control and Safety Protocols

  • Enhanced Personal Protective Equipment (PPE): Dentists and staff continue to wear masks, gloves, and gowns during patient encounters. Some practices have also introduced N95 respirators for added protection.
  • Improved Ventilation: Improved ventilation systems and increased air exchanges are essential to reduce the risk of airborne transmission.
  • Rigorous Disinfection: Regular and thorough disinfection of all surfaces, equipment, and instruments is crucial to prevent the spread of infection.

Technology Integration

  • Telehealth: Virtual consultations and video appointments continue to be valuable tools for patient triage, follow-up appointments, and non-urgent care.
  • Digital Imaging: The use of digital x-rays and intraoral scanners has increased, reducing the need for physical impressions and minimizing patient contact.
  • Patient Management Software: Cloud-based patient management software helps streamline appointments, manage patient records, and facilitate online communication.

Patient Management Strategies

  • Flexible Scheduling: Staggering appointments and extending operating hours can reduce the number of patients in the office at any given time.
  • Virtual Waiting Rooms: Patients can wait in their vehicles or remotely via a virtual waiting room system.
  • Enhanced Patient Education: Clear and concise patient education materials help patients understand the new infection control protocols and expectations.

Staff Management

  • Flexible Work Arrangements: Hybrid work models and remote work options can help accommodate staff concerns and maintain a healthy work-life balance.
  • Ongoing Training: Staff must receive comprehensive training on infection control protocols and the latest technological advancements.
  • Employee Support Programs: Mental health and wellness programs can provide support to staff during stressful times.

The Future of Dentistry in the Post-Pandemic Era

As the pandemic continues to shape the healthcare landscape, dentistry is poised to emerge transformed and resilient.

  • Increased Focus on Infection Control: Enhanced infection control protocols are likely to become the new standard in dental practice, ensuring patient safety and peace of mind.
  • Continued Integration of Technology: Digital technologies will continue to play a vital role in providing efficient and convenient dental care.
  • Patient-Centered Approach: Dental practices will place a greater emphasis on patient comfort, convenience, and personalization.
  • Increased Demand for Comprehensive Care: Patients are becoming more aware of the importance of oral health and are seeking comprehensive dental care that addresses both immediate and long-term needs.
  • Collaboration and Innovation: Collaboration between dental professionals, researchers, and technology providers will drive innovation and improve patient outcomes.
